USG 3 [Opgelost] USG-3P macOS Terminal, command "ls -l" in root geeft output 0 files/folders

UniFi USG 3

m4v3r1ck

$ sudo -i
UniFier
31 jan 2018
3.633
3
1.761
163
SSH naar mijn USG-3P gaat langzaam en krijg de onderstaande - voor mij - vreemde output. Ik krijg direct na de inlog een output van 0 na command 'ls -l" in /root. Heen en weer naar de folder /etc of ander geeft daarna wel een output.

Code:
@USG-3P-UTL:~$ sudo -i
root@USG-3P-UTL:~# ls -l
total 0
root@USG-3P-UTL:~# cd /etc
root@USG-3P-UTL:/etc# ls -l
total 318
-rw-r--r--    1 root     root          2981 Feb 12  2021 adduser.conf
drwxr-xr-x    2 root     root           707 Feb 12  2021 alternatives
# etc...
root@USG-3P-UTL:/etc# cd /
root@USG-3P-UTL:/# ls -l
total 2496
drwxr-xr-x    2 root     root          1038 Feb 12  2021 bin
drwxr-xr-x    2 root     root             3 May 30  2016 boot
#etc...

Ik heb inmiddels mijn USG al 2x herstart.
 
Even een afbeelding van het "top" command in macOS Terminal van mijn USG-3P als root "sudo -i". Dat lijkt me een prima belasting van CPU/MEM.

Screenshot 2021-10-05 at 11.20.29.png

Ik snap dus niet waarom die listing niet direct werkt, iemand een suggestie om dat te onderzoeken?
 
Ik dacht dat EDGEOS/EDGEMAX alleen voor de EdgeRouters was, en dat de USG (3P) altijd door de unifi network controller/Cloudkey beheerd werd ?
 
De USG is - leerde ik - gebaseerd op de EdgeRouter en dus heb ik de UserGuide van de EdgeRouter gedownload. Ik zocht de CLI command list voor de USG.

Inderdaad wordt de USG gemanaged door de controller, in mijn geval de UCKG2+.
 
Als je op de USG inlogt kom je niet in de root directory van de USG terecht maar in de home directory van het account waarmee je inlogt. En die is dus gewoon leeg. Vandaar dat je geheel terecht 0 als resultaat krijgt.

Je moet dus eerst naar de root toe.

Dus:
- Inloggen
- commando 'cd /'
- commando 'ls -l'

Als je direct na het inloggen het commando 'pwd' geeft zul je zien dat je eerst in directory /home/<usernaam> zit.

Het sudo -i commando is nergens voor nodig. Sowieso niet verstandig om direct op sudo level te gaan zitten want dan kun je zonder waarschuwing de USG om zeep helpen. :)
 
  • Leuk
Waarderingen: m4v3r1ck
Dankjewel @Hofstede voor je inhoudelijke reactie en toelichting op het sudo -i, ik ben dus gewaarschuwd. ;)

Code:
<usernaam>@USG-3P-UTL:~$ pwd
/home/<usernaam>
<usernaam>@USG-3P-UTL:~$
 
Activiteit
Er wordt op dit moment (nog) geen nieuwe reactie gepost.
  Topic Status: Hallo . Er is al meer dan 14 dagen geen nieuwe reactie meer geplaatst.
  De inhoud is mogelijk niet langer relevant.
  Misschien is het beter om in plaats daarvan een nieuw onderwerp te starten..